AddrSnap widget — account recovery. If the Quenby admin account locks after failed OTP attempts, stop retries immediately. Confirm lockout in the Lathe console, clear the throttle flag, and restart the suggestion service. Do not rotate keys mid-incident. To unlock the recovery console, enter the passphrase below.

unlock words, yawig-kagef: gordor-holvan-ulaael-pramir-ulaiel-tamdor

## Ticket: Health-check drift behind the Marlowe LB

Plugin authors: we've found configuration drift between the health-check settings the Marlowe load balancer expects and what several third-party plugins register at startup. Some plugins override the probe path and interval, causing the balancer to mark healthy nodes as down during deploys. Going forward, plugins must not override probe settings; the platform owns them. Please audit your manifests against the canonical values. The settings the balancer currently enforces are listed below.

config for kafof-bawef:
holath:
  log_level: debug
  metrics_host: metrics.holath.qorvelsys.internal
  pin: 2191
  pool_size: 32

The renewal of our three-year agreement with Torvane Materials has been assessed in detail. Proposed terms include a 4.2% unit-price increase, partially offset by improved volume rebates and extended payment terms of sixty days. Sensitivity analysis indicates a net annual cost impact of under 1% on the Meridia product line, assuming stable demand. Legal has flagged no material changes to liability clauses. We recommend approval, subject to the conditions outlined in the confidential note below.

confidential, yawip-bahif: Zorokox Partners plans to lower the Casax list price by 28.0 percent in April. The board signed off on a budget of $271.0 million for Project Juldor. The renewal with Pelokox Partners closes at $410.1 million a year, 3.4 percent below the last contract. Project Pelok slips by a full year because of the audit delay.